Web10 Aug 2011 · An aspiring author during the civil rights movement of the 1960s decides to write a book detailing the African American maids' point of view on the white families for … WebThe Help is a historical fiction novel by American author Kathryn Stockett and published by Penguin Books in 2009. The story is about African Americans working in white households in Jackson, Mississippi, during the early 1960s.. A USA Today article called it one of the "summer sleeper hits."
